Summary:This article introduces mathematical models and algorithm for calculation of wire shapes of specified length, which are inscribed in an arbitrary trapezium. This helps to save workspace, which is especially important for any-angle routing. The presented algorithm allows maintaining the defined wire length with a maximum tolerance of 50 nm. For compatibility with CAD formats that do not support arc-shaped wires, TopoR creates approximated snake-like connections made up of straight lines only.
